INTRODUCTION
The VP, Software Product Management is a senior executive leader responsible for defining, aligning, and scaling software product strategy across business units, spanning Android, Windows, Linux, Chrome and Aluminum operating systems, across Mobile, Compute, XR, Wearables, Automotive, IoT, Datacenter and emerging AI platforms. This role provides horizontal leadership across multiple software product lines, identifying and structuring Software Product (SP) activities by high-level-operating system (HLOS), driving clarity across BU roadmaps, and ensuring that software investments align with Qualcomm’s long term platform strategy with decentralized BU ownership. Operating at the intersection of software product strategy, cross-BU influence, and ecosystem execution, this leader partners closely with engineering, program management, and executive stakeholders to align roadmaps across Mobile, Compute, XR, Wearables, Automotive, IoT, and Datacenter business units. The role plays a critical stewardship function for cross-BU software mainline and derivative strategies, open-source engagement, and system-level tooling and infrastructure—including developer tools, AI Hub enablement, and software publishing frameworks—while holding teams accountable to shared platform objectives such as OneSP. Success requires strong executive influence, deep software domain credibility, and the ability to create alignment, visibility, and leverage across independently funded organizations to maximize Snapdragon’s platform impact.
ROLE AND RESPONSIBILITIES
- Define and drive the software product and platform strategy across Linux, Android, Windows, Aluminum and Chrome OS, ensuring alignment and consistency across operating system ecosystems.
- Lead and influence the development of scalable software architectures that span multiple Snapdragon business segments, including Mobile, Compute, XR, Wearables, Automotive, IoT, and Datacenter.
- Establish and execute open-source software and upstreaming strategies, ensuring Qualcomm maintains strong technical leadership, ecosystem credibility, and long-term platform sustainability.
- Drive software portability and reuse across multiple generations of Snapdragon and Dragonwing hardware, maximizing platform leverage, reducing fragmentation, and accelerating time to market.
- Partner closely with core technology, systems, and engineering teams to translate silicon and platform capabilities into coherent software product roadmaps.
- Define and evolve software offerings and enablement roadmaps for third-party application developers and ISVs, strengthening the Snapdragon software ecosystem.
- Provide cross-functional leadership and influence across product management, engineering, and business unit teams, building consensus in a highly matrixed organization.
- Guide and align software execution across multiple teams to ensure delivery against strategic platform objectives and long-term roadmap commitments.
- Represent Qualcomm and the Snapdragon & Dragonwing software strategy through domestic and international engagement, including customer, partner, and ecosystem interactions, with approximately 30% travel.
M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S
- Bachelor's degree in Computer/Electrical Engineering, Computer Science, or related field.
- Fifteen (15) years of Product Management or related work experience.
- Six (6) years of leadership experience.
- Four (4) years of working in a large matrixed organization.
- Two (2) years of working with operating budgets and/or project financials.
- Two (2) years of negotiating 3rd party business agreements.
This leadership role can be based in San Diego or Santa Clara, California.

How do I navigate the H-1B filing timeline after receiving a Qualcomm offer?
If you need a cap-subject H-1B, Qualcomm must register you during the USCIS lottery window in March, with employment starting no earlier than October 1 if selected. Build this into your start date negotiation. If you're transferring from another H-1B employer, portability under the American Competitiveness in the Twenty-First Century Act lets you start work once USCIS receives the new petition, without waiting for approval.
